Raiders star goes to the bin
Simaima Taufa, a prominent player for the Raiders, found herself in the sin bin during a crucial match due to a controversial hip-drop tackle. This incident has sparked debate about the rules surrounding such tackles and their impact on player safety in rugby league. As one of the team's key figures, her temporary absence highlights the fine line between aggressive play and dangerous maneuvers that can lead to disciplinary action. The broader implications suggest a potential shift in how referees enforce rules to balance competitive spirit with player welfare.
